Subject: [PATCH] git-blame --incremental: don't use pager
Date: Sun, 28 Jan 2007 15:25:55 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<45BCB273.7010601@lsrfire.ath.cx>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<7vps8zfqlx.fsf@assigned-by-dhcp.cox.net>
Starting a pager defeats the purpose of the incremental output
mode. This changes git-blame to only paginate if --incremental
was not given.
git -p blame --incremental still starts the pager, though.
Signed-off-by: Rene Scharfe <rene.scharfe@lsrfire.ath.cx>
---
builtin-blame.c | 3 +++
git.c | 2 +-
2 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
diff --git a/builtin-blame.c b/builtin-blame.c
index 7a58ee3..02bda5e 100644
--- a/builtin-blame.c
+++ b/builtin-blame.c
@@ -1780,6 +1780,9 @@ int cmd_blame(int argc, const char **argv, const char *prefix)
argv[unk++] = arg;
}
+ if (!incremental)
+ setup_pager();
+
if (!blame_move_score)
blame_move_score = BLAME_DEFAULT_MOVE_SCORE;
if (!blame_copy_score)
diff --git a/git.c b/git.c
index 530e99f..e9febc3 100644
--- a/git.c
+++ b/git.c
@@ -217,7 +217,7 @@ static void handle_internal_command(int argc, const char **argv, char **envp)
{ "annotate", cmd_annotate, USE_PAGER },
{ "apply", cmd_apply },
{ "archive", cmd_archive },
- { "blame", cmd_blame, RUN_SETUP | USE_PAGER },
+ { "blame", cmd_blame, RUN_SETUP },
{ "branch", cmd_branch, RUN_SETUP },
{ "cat-file", cmd_cat_file, RUN_SETUP },
{ "checkout-index", cmd_checkout_index, RUN_SETUP },
